## Incremental rebuilds at Moorhenge

Welcome aboard! Our docs site doesn't rebuild from scratch — the Slatewisp builder diffs content hashes and only regenerates changed pages, which keeps deploys under a minute. You'll mostly never touch this, but if you're setting up a local pipeline, Slatewisp needs to authenticate against the hash cache or it falls back to full rebuilds. Put the cache auth secret in your env file on the next line:

sealed setting: ARCHIVE_KEY3=8d0

**Mgmt Meeting Minutes — Retiring the Brightline Range**

Quick recap for sales leads at Fenholt Supplies: we agreed to retire the Brightline fixture range by year-end. Remaining stock moves to clearance pricing next month, and accounts on standing orders get migrated to the Lumetta range. Trade-in incentives were approved in principle. The confidential note on next steps sits just below.

board note of bajof-bajeg: The pricing group signed off on a budget of $13.4 million for Project Sildor. The renewal with Lamixek Holdings closes at $48.9 million a year, 49 percent above the last contract.

## Formula sandbox tuning

User-supplied formulas in Gridmoor execute inside a restricted interpreter with hard ceilings on time, memory, and call depth. Reviewers should confirm any change to these ceilings is justified in the PR description, since raising them widens the abuse surface. Defaults were chosen from production traces. The current limits are as follows.

limits module of tafog-fawip:
WEIGHTS = {
    "julix": 57,
    "lamys": 992,
    "kasvan": 209,
    "quenok": 750,
    "alddor": 259,
    "oliath": 1009,
    "wenix": 815,
}

Action item from the Vigilroom proctoring queue incident: the retry storm occurred because requeue delay was shorter than the verification timeout, letting unverified sessions re-enter the queue and amplify load. We are codifying the corrected values in config and adding a startup assertion that delay exceeds timeout. The revised queue constants are as follows.

tuning table, kajog-bawip:
TIERS = {
    "kelius": 256,
    "lammir": 543,
}